DB-502 Double Door Refrigerator Training and Assessment Device
I. Overview
The dual door refrigerator training and assessment device integrates the refrigeration system, electrical control system, and fault setting system, visually demonstrating the system structure and refrigeration principle of this refrigerator. The structure and main components of the refrigeration cycle system can be clearly seen, and the system is equipped with AC voltage meters, temperature meters, vacuum high and low voltage meters, and signal indicator lights, making the real-time operation of the entire refrigerator system clear at a glance.
Double door refrigerator training and assessment deviceSuitable for teaching and practical training in skills appraisal, assessment work, refrigeration technology in vocational colleges and schools, principles and maintenance of household refrigeration equipment, and refrigeration equipment maintenance workers.

2、 Technical performance
1. Power supply AC 220V ± 10% 50Hz
2. Rated input power 400W
3. Rated input current 1A
4. Refrigerant R600a
5. Overall dimensions (approximately) 1000 × 700 × 1606mm
6. Safety protection measures include overvoltage, overcurrent, overload, and leakage protection, which comply with relevant national standards.
7. The selection of environmentally friendly materials complies with relevant national environmental standards
3、 Basic equipment of the device
1. Training cabinet: Iron double-layer matte texture spray coating structure, aluminum panel. Two control valves have been added to the refrigeration system for switching between different evaporators when converting between direct cooling and indirect cooling refrigerators, and for completing fault simulation training of the refrigeration system. There is a sight glass installed in the pipeline for easy observation of the refrigerant's condition. There is a cabinet at the bottom of the training cabinet for placing training cables, tools, and other training supplies. The refrigerator door adopts a transparent design, making it easy to observe the frosting and condensation on the surface of the evaporator. The condenser is externally located behind the refrigerator.
2. One AC voltmeter: measuring range 0-250V, accuracy level 1.5, used for monitoring power supply voltage.
3. One AC ammeter: measuring range of 0-5A, accuracy level 1.5, used to observe the starting current and normal working current of the system.
4. Four thermometers: equipped with PT100 sensors and a three and a half digit digital display, capable of measuring the temperature of the freezer, refrigerator, condenser inlet and outlet respectively.
5. By using a flowchart and measuring instruments, the positions of each measuring point can be directly displayed, allowing students to have a more intuitive understanding of the changes in operating data of the refrigeration system;
5. Two vacuum pressure gauges: measuring ranges of -0.1 to 0.9MPa and -0.1 to 1.5MPa, capable of displaying the pressure on both the low-pressure and high-pressure sides of the system.
6. One simulated fault setting box: embedded in the training cabinet, used for simulating fault settings and equipped with a lock. The types of faults that can be set include: power circuit, lighting circuit, defrosting circuit, compressor protection circuit, etc.
7. One set of current type leakage protection device: When the ground leakage current exceeds a certain value, it will trip and cut off the power supply; Equipped with thermal protection devices to provide overheating and overload protection for the compressor.
8. One set of training connection cable: The training connection cable and socket adopt an anti electric shock structure, which is safe, reliable, and anti electric shock.
